JAM Project and FLOW Performing at ANI:ME Abu Dhabi This October

The first sliver of news finally comes in for the ANI:ME convention and it’s a doozy! Live music performances by two of the most iconic anime music supergroups JAM Project and FLOW will be headlining the event at du Forum, Yas Island in Abu Dhabi on 27th to 29th October 2016.

 

JAM Project

JAM Project

JAM (Japanese Animationsong Makers) Project is an anisong group formed on July 19, 2000 consisting of Hironobu Kageyama, Masaaki Endoh, Hiroshi Kitadani, Masami Okui and Yoshiki Fukuyama. Individually, they are some of the anime music industry’s biggest musicians. As a group, they’ve been smashing the charts with their songs included in popular anime like Bakuman., Super Robot Taisen, Yu-Gi-Oh! GX and their most recent hit, “The Hero” from One Punch Man. They’ll be singing songs from their work as a group as well as individuals and personally, I can’t wait to hear Hiroshi Kitadani’s One Piece legendary opening song “We Are” live.

FLOW

FLOW

FLOW is a Japanese rock band which was formed back in 1998, so they’re industry veterans without a doubt. Comprising of the two vocalists Keigo Hayashi and Koushi Asakawa, Takeshi Asakawa, the lead guitarist, Hiroshi Iwasaki on drums and Yasutarou Gotou (their magnificent bass guitarist), FLOW has performed some of anime’s greatest hits. The one that immediately comes to mind is “GO!!!” and “Re:member” from Naruto’s fourth and eighth OP respectively.  Moreover, with works in Seven Deadly Sins, Beelzebub, Durarara!!x2 Ketsu, Tales of Zestiria the X, Samurai Flamenco and Code Geass.

Ticket Prices

Tickets will be available soon online through ticketmaster.com and at Virgin Megastore outlets across the GCC region.

VIP (3 Days) – 550 AED (Pre-Event) | 650 AED (At Event)
Gold (3 Days) – 250 AED (Pre-Event) | 350 AED (At Event)
Silver (1 Day) – 95 AED (Pre-Event) | 50 AED (At Event)
